directions

  • Season chicken with salt and pepper. Fry in oil for 8-10 minutes until golden on both sides.
  • Add stock, marmalade and thyme. Simmer for 5 minutes, remove chicken and boil mixture until reduced and syrupy and pour over chicken.
  • Serve.

  1. This is really delcious and easy to make and it reheats well, too! The first time around, we had it with rice and the second time with couscous. I found, though, that even with boiling hard, the juices wouldn't thicken so in the end, it added a bit of cornstarch mixed with cold water and that did the trick.
